A Level 2 Electrician isn't your daily sparky. While a general electrician might handle internal wiring, lighting installations, and power point repairs, the Level 2 expert operates on a different plane, authorised to work straight on the service network infrastructure. This includes overhead and underground service lines, metering devices, and the essential connections that bring power from the street to a client's premises. They are the ones you call when your service fuse blows, when you require a brand-new power pole installed, or when you're updating your switchboard to manage increased power demands. Their work is typically carried out at height, underground, or in close proximity to live wires, demanding a severe awareness of danger and a meticulous adherence to safety protocols.

The journey to becoming a Level 2 Electrician is a challenging but fulfilling one, demanding significant dedication. It usually starts with finishing a Certificate III in Electrotechnology Electrician, followed by numerous years of practical experience as a certified electrician. This fundamental knowledge then paves the way for specialised training and assessment that covers the particular nuances of dealing with the service network. Ambitious Level 2 specialists should show efficiency in areas such as overhead service work, underground service work, metering, and disconnections/reconnections. This rigorous training ensures they possess the required expertise to deal with complex circumstances safely and effectively, frequently involving live electrical parts where a single error might have serious consequences.

Their know-how extends to a broad variety of critical services. When a new home is constructed, it's the Level 2 Electrician who connects it to the mains power supply, setting up the meter and guaranteeing all required security checks are carried out. Likewise, if a property undergoes considerable renovation or needs an upgrade to its electrical capacity, these are the experts who examine the existing facilities, perform the needed upgrades to theboard, and make sure the entire system can securely manage the increased load. They are likewise instrumental in emergency situation situations, responding to power failures, repairing storm-damaged get more info lines, and rectifying problems that compromise the stability of the power supply. Their swift and definitive actions in these situations are essential in restoring power and minimising interruption for homeowners and companies.

Beyond brand-new setups and repairs, Level 2 Electricians play a vital function in maintaining the existing electrical infrastructure. They conduct routine evaluations, recognize prospective dangers, and carry out preventative maintenance to reduce dangers and extend the life-span of electrical elements. This proactive technique is crucial in preventing costly breakdowns and ensuring the continued reliability of the power supply. Their work is thoroughly recorded and sticks to rigid industry requirements and regulations, guaranteeing compliance and accountability in all their operations.
